Carquest acquisition was a disaster

I left Advance recently, just ahead of these cuts apparently. Agree with other comments, the Carquest acquisition was a disaster - looking back AAP really got nothing from the integration: in my region, at least 75% of the knowledgeable Carquest people left the organization in the 12 months following the deal, AAP did not take advantage at all of the expanded distribution footprint (remember 5x delivery?) and morale was an ongoing problem.

Store sales targets were random, you know that if you'd had 2 good years of beating target you'd pay the price in the third year with unachievable targets. I had stores that were running a 10% or better comp and still missing target, when the company as a whole was running a flat sales comp. AAP will be acquired by someone, these numerous stumbles have been disastrous and AAP lags behind it's competition with Wall St.
